Molecular Stepping Stones features online activities, including simulations, to help students understand 10 key concepts underlying many biological processes. Topics include atomic structure, random motion, spatial equilibrium, strong chemical bonds, compounds, intermolecular forces, self-assembly, proteins, chemical reactions and catalysis, DNA, and biologica. (The Concord Consortium, supported by National Science Foundation)
Interesting fact: In the Strong Chemical Bonds activity, students explore the role of electronegativity in bond formation by setting the electronegativity of two bonded atoms. They will see that ionic bonds form between atoms of very disparate electronegativities, that polar covalent bonds form between atoms of somewhat disparate electronegativities, and non-polar covalent bonds form between atoms that have similar electronegativity.
